Why The Indiana Pacers Do The Deal

If the Warriors are open to giving up on the youth movement, the Pacers should give them a call. After all, they should be all-in on theirs.

For Indiana, this deal is all about potential. They’re not getting a first-round pick here, but they’re getting three players who were very recently selected in the first round.

Of course, that understates the return a little. James Wiseman was selected second overall in the 2020 draft. Granted, he’s failed to live up to that billing. He still has potential as a hyper-athletic big man who defends the rim and spaces the floor a little. If he hits his ceiling, he could be Myles Turner – with a vertical.

Meanwhile, Patrick Baldwin Jr. was once seen as a lock to land in the NBA lottery. He slipped to 28th after a disastrous season of college basketball. He still holds high potential as a 6’10 wing with a sweet shooting stroke.

Finally, Moody might be the best player in this whole package. He appears to be a 3-and-D wing with secondary playmaking abilities on the side. He’s also likely got the highest floor of the group. With that said, if even one of these three hit their ceiling for Indiana, this trade will look great for them in hindsight.
